Description:
The third step in Ultimatum’s Ascendant Organic line of robotics, the V-2 is much more invasive than the previous augmentation. Rather than the simple removal of arms or legs, this unit requires the removal of all organic parts excluding the head. Through a number of cleverly designed nutrient distribution devices the organic head is kept in a near perfect condition for as long as the unit is active. Due to the amount of cybernetic implanting straight into the brain, and as combat protection, a full covering helmet has been integrated into the design. In cases where danger to the organic head is considered negligent, it is possible for helmet to retract into the armor, thereby revealing the rather terrifying visage of these volunteers.
Due to the inherent weakness that relying on a single organic head portrays, Ultimatum took a step further and went into study potential methods of maintaining the safety of the organic head even should the helmet fail to protect it. This led him to the discovery that by the integration of doses of bacta into the nutrient tubes would ensure that increased survival rates. Through the use of advanced reparative functions Ultimatum was further able to make a definitive calculation that the system could be overburdened should the head take three consecutive blasts within a short time period, or a significantly large enough hit so as to leave little left. Further should the environmental shield fail, the head would be vulnerable to extreme temperatures, requiring that the helmet remain up, otherwise the unit would die.
The shields used are almost equal to that on light vehicles, intended to be able to absorb most fire from standard infantry. More importantly it is intended to negate the considerable danger of electronic warfare. The use of specialized rods to direct extraneous electrical currents to the feet does remove some of the danger, but not entirely. A simple barrage of multiple ion shots that pierce the shield are likely to fry circuits that protect the head. The electric attacks are more likely to damage the more outlying systems, but if it should damage the life support system the head has a limited window of survival. As the entirety of survival is based on the maintaining of nutrient flows, if it is disrupted then the head usually has an average of two minutes to survive the ordeal. If the damage is repaired within that time then the brain will not have suffered any severe and permanent effects, while longer will leave definite damage if not death. The closer to the two minute mark the more likely some form of damage is likely to have occurred.
The body itself is intended to be a sturdier, more powerful version of previous droid builds. The V-2 was intended for duel usage, the first and most obvious was as a combat unit capable of fitting into many different roles. The other, perhaps subtler usage was as an emergency responder, akin to the firemen or paramedics of old. They were built tall and bulky, firstly because that was the most practical method of fitting all of the various mechanisms into one body, and secondly because it could instill terror in one situation and awe in another depending on the point of view. From the above lists the unit can only be loaded with one of the devices from each section, thus one V-2 may have a Grenade Launcher and Bacta Dispersal on its back while on its arms it may have a Cyroban sprayer and High-intensity Laser cutter. At any one time, the energy output for each of these devices allows for only one from each category, excluding Standard which come with every unit.
On the battlefield the unit is intended to participate in different roles depending on the pre-selected loud-out, due to the constraints of the complex devices, it requires a full five hours to change a full loud-out. The unit has been fitted with reactive shielding in the form of a high electrical current in the inner and outer armor plating with a heavy rubber insulator in between, when a conventional armor-piercing projectile breaks through the outer layer, the rubber will be pierced and when it strikes the inner armor it completes the circuit. On most weapons this will turn the projectile into plasma, which is diffused and what does hit the internal armor it is easily deflected by the heavy Duranium. The outer armor is strong enough to protect the unit from most conventional weaponry.
The launcher is capable of using standard launcher grenades as well as the specially made Overseer grenades. The drone launcher is a relative of this launcher that is used to launcher an Overseer from the back of a V-2. These use less power and are normally considered to be preferable to use when adding a Droid Command Module, or Sensor Pods as these two draw considerably more energy.
The minor Artillery is as the name suggests a lesser version of a standard artillery. It can be loaded with most small rounds. It is usually more useful in a support role when utilizing this weapon as the unit must remain stationary while firing and reloading, also the device is usually not suggested to be utilized while the unit has a bacta dispersal unit as the shock wave from the firing damages the system of the dispersal unit.
The Hazardous Material Pack is intended for the transport and release of any substance considered dangerous to organics. The pack is sealed and layered to keep radiation, toxins, and microbes easily contained until release. This is usually a tactic for close quarters combat. (Does not come with any hazardous material)
The flamethrower and Cyroban spray are similar mechanics to standard versions used throughout the galaxy. Each is capable of maintaining a half-minute steady usage at one time. The Cryoban is capable of acting as an organic deterrent and as a fire suppression system.
The integrated launcher are not new inventions. Rather updated versions of the ancient B2 Super Battle Droid. The launcher fires basic rockets, but it is also capable of firing specially constructed concussion missiles, however this is a rarity.

Normally a V-2 will also be outfitted with non-combat systems, these will normally be placed on the opposite side of the weaponry systems. For example if a minor artillery is attached on the right shoulder and a flamethrower on the left arm, one system for the back can be attached to the left side and an arm attachment may be put on the right arm.
The Bacta Dispersal system is based on the concept of bacta grenades in a more advanced system. The container for the system contains approximately three gallons of bacta and has approximate ten uses if each release lasts for two seconds. The system sprays fine bacta in a two meter diameter around the unit, though wind, temperature, and other outside forces will create variations in this. (Purchase Bacta separately)
Automatic Repair servos is an extra attachment that when installed actually covers a larger portion of the back, upper arms, and upper legs. The system is a layer of various repair parts and mechanisms that are placed under a protective layer of Duranium. The system is capable of repairing minor damage to internal components, whether it be fractured or melted. This is also capable of repairing small cuts in the metal armor with molten durasteel that hardens soon after being released.
The Energy Expansion Pack is a simple generator system that increases the lifespan of the unit. This allows for the V-2 to run an additional six hours before requiring a recharge. When recharging the generator will require a refill on its fuel rods every twenty minutes.
High-intensity Laser Cutters are very similar to plasma cutters, but more powerful and intended for thicker, stronger materials. The cutter is capable of cutting through its own armor, but little more (8 is the limit) however this takes five minutes of a concentration on a singular point. The Cutter is intended to pierce starship hulls, this allows it to be used for anti-armor purposes as well as rescuing missions. The cutter requires a considerable amount of power and is not suggested to work in conjunction with other power hungry equipment.
The Explosive Bolt Dispenser is a simple device that punches an explosive bolt into a surface. The intent being to separate two pieces of metal or similar situations. It is intended as a mainly rescue implement. The device requires ten seconds motionless to force the bolt into the material. The bolt is incapable of piercing stronger armors and therefore useless when put up against vehicles or well armored (5) individuals. While usable on the battlefield it is ill advised.
Utilizing the Insight technology, a V-2 with this can detect most forms of conventional stealth technology. This system requires the use of the Energy Expansion Pack.
